Sometimes laughter really is the best medicine. 

Tonight Show fans will be happy to know that host Jimmy Fallon is on the mend after stepping out in New York for the first time since undergoing minor surgery for a hand injury. Reportedly taking a helicopter ride to the Hamptons, the funnyman accessorized his dark sunglasses and baseball cap with a white cast around his left wrist and pinky and ring fingers. 

"Tweeting with one hand," Fallon captioned a photo of his hand all wrapped up after the June 26 accident. "Tripped and caught my fall (good thing)! Ring caught on side of table almost ripped my finger off (bad thing)."

Since then, the 40-year-old has continued to share on Twitter details about the recovery process. 

"All looking great!! Thank you to these great doctors and nurses and Jello," Fallon explained. After a fan asked how his hand was healing, Jimmy replied, "Great. But was a little scary. Story to come when we return!"

It's safe to say the comedian will probably have some great material when he gets back to his late night gig after two weeks away.  

"I think I've invented a new type of wedding ring. Let's talk...  Neil? Kay? Jared? #IGotIdeas," Fallon continued to joke.
